urban - (adj) relating to towns and cities, suburban - (adj) in a suburb, relating to a suburb, or typical of a suburb, rural - (adj) relating to the countryside, or in the countryside, smog - (n) polluted air that forms a cloud close to the ground, fog - (n) thick clouds that form close to the ground are difficult to see through, smoke - (n) a grey, black or white cloud that is produced by something that is burning, mist - (n) a mass of small drops of water in the air close to the ground, weather - (n) the conditions that exist in the atmosphere, for example whether it is hot, cold, sunny, or wet, climate - (n) the climate of a country or region is the type of weather it has, forecast - (n) a statement about what is likely to happen, usually relating to the weather, business or the economy, prediction - (n) a statement about what you think will happen in the future, waste - (n) the useless materials, substances or parts that are left after you have used something, litter - (n) things that people have dropped on the ground in a public place, making it untidy, rubbish - (n) things that you throw away because they are no longer useful, clean - (adj) not dirty or polluted, clear - (adj) if the sky is clear, there are no clouds, pour - (v) to rain very hard, drizzle - (v) to rain very lightly, flood - (v) to cover a place with water, or to become covered with water, environment - (n) the natural world, including the land, water, air, plants and animals, surroundings - (n) a place and all the things in it, wind - (n) a natural current of air that move fast enough for you to feel it, air - (n) the mixture of gases that we breathe, reservoir - (n) a lake, often an artificial one, where water is stored so that it can be supplied to houses, factories, etc, lake - (n) a large area of water surrounded by land, puddle - (n) a small pool of water that is left on the ground after it has rained, pond - (n) an area of water that is smaller than a lake, thunder - (n) a loud noise that you sometimes hear in the sky during a storm, lightning - (n) the bright flashes of light that you see in the sky during a storm, global - (adj) including or affecting the whole world,
